At the start of the German Biathlon Championships on the Arber, there was a first little surprise. Overall World Cup winner Franziska Preuss had to give up a returnee.
Janina Hettich-Walz is the new German single champion. The biathlete won over 12.5 kilometers ahead of Franziska Preuß on Friday. The 29-year-old lead over the second place, both of them shot one mistake.
For Hettich-Walz it was the first competition after her baby break. In February she gave birth to a daughter. Due to pregnancy, Hettich Walz completely missed the 2024/25 season. After the single title in 2020 and the sprint victory a year later, this is already your third championship title.
In the 2023/24 season, the sports soldier had had its most successful season to date. In the overall World Cup she became tenth, at the World Cup in Nove Mesto she won silver in singles and bronze with the season.
The returnee Voigt drives onto the podium
Third place at the championship singles went to another returnee on Friday: Vanessa Voigt. The 27-year-old had stopped the past season early due to health problems. At the Arber she stayed flawlessly at the shooting range, her gap to the top was 1:43 minutes.
For the men, Philipp Horn won the title in front of Lucas Fratzscher and Justus Strelow on the 15 kilometers of Philipp Horn despite four shooting errors. The ski roller races in the Bavarian Forest are also about grief for the ex-athlete Laura Dahlmeier, who had an accident during mountaineering. Among other things, there was a minute’s silence on Friday in the stadium, and a highlight clip from Dahlmeier’s career was recorded on the scoreboard.
